Sådan tilføjes zombier til Unity-spil
Tilføjelse af Zombies til Unity kan være et spændende projekt for spiludviklere, der ønsker at skabe deres eget zombie-tema-spil. I denne guide vil vi dække processen trin for trin, med et særligt fokus på at tilføje zombiemodeller for at forbedre dit spils visuelle appel. Husk, at denne vejledning forudsætter, at du har en grundlæggende forståelse af Unity og C# programmering.
For at tilføje zombier til dit Unity-spil skal du overveje 3 hoveddele: Zombie-modeller, Zombie-animationer og Zombie AI.
Forudsætninger
- Unity Installeret: Sørg for, at du har Unity installeret på din computer. Download den seneste version fra den officielle Unity hjemmeside.
- Grundlæggende Unity færdigheder: Gør dig bekendt med Unity-grænsefladen og få en grundlæggende forståelse af spiludviklingskoncepter.
Trin til at tilføje zombier til Unity
1. Opsæt et nyt Unity-projekt
- Åbn Unity og opret et nyt 3D-projekt.
- Juster projektindstillinger baseret på dine præferencer.
2. Opret eller importer zombiemodeller
- Tjek Unity Asset Store for forskellige zombiemodelpakker: Zombiepakker.
- Download og importer en zombiemodelpakke, eller lav dine egne zombiemodeller.
3. Organiser dit projekt
- Opret mapper for at opretholde en organiseret projektstruktur (f.eks. scripts, materialer, modeller).
4. Tilføjelse af zombiemodeller til scenen
- Træk og slip zombiemodellerne ind i din Unity-scene.
- Juster skalaen, positionen og rotationen af modellerne efter behov.
5. Konfiguration af zombieanimationer
- Hvis dine zombiemodeller inkluderer animationer, skal du konfigurere Animator-komponenten for hver zombie, ellers tjek disse Zombie-animationer.
- Definer animationsovergange for at skabe realistiske zombiebevægelser.
6. Implementering af Zombie AI
- Opret et C#-script til at kontrollere zombieadfærd (f.eks. at vandre, jagte, angribe), eller brug en tredjeparts Zombie AI.
- Vedhæft scriptet til hvert zombie GameObject.
7. Implementering af Zombie Spawning
- Udvikl et system til at skabe zombier på bestemte steder.
- Overvej at implementere et bølgesystem til at kontrollere, hvornår og hvor mange zombier, der gyder.
8. Spillerinteraktion
- Implementer spillerkontroller og interaktioner (f.eks. skydemekanik).
- Tillad spillere at forsvare sig mod zombier.
9. Brugergrænseflade (UI)
- Design en brugergrænseflade til at vise afgørende information (f.eks. spillersundhed, ammunitionstal, bølgeinformation), eller brug klar-til-brug UI-pakker.
10. Test og fejlretning
- Test dit spil regelmæssigt for at identificere og løse eventuelle problemer.
- Brug Unity's fejlfindingsværktøjer til at identificere og løse problemer i dine scripts.
11. Optimering
- Optimer dit spil til ydeevne ved at administrere ressourcer effektivt og bruge Unity's profileringsværktøjer.
12. Polering
- Tilføj lydeffekter, baggrundsmusik og eventuelle yderligere funktioner for at forbedre den overordnede spiloplevelse.
Inspiration fra COD Zombies
Overvej at studere populære spil som Call of Duty (COD) Zombies for at få inspiration til zombieadfærd, billeder og den generelle atmosfære. Analyser, hvad der gør disse spil engagerende, og prøv at inkorporere lignende elementer i dit projekt.
Konklusion
Ved at følge ovenstående trin vil du føje zombier til dit Unity-spil. Husk løbende at teste, gentage og forfine dit spil for at skabe en engagerende og fornøjelig spilleroplevelse. Held og lykke med udviklingen af dit zombie-tema!